Exploring The Beauty And Charm Of Ventura

Nestled along the stunning coastline of California, Ventura is a city that captures the essence of laid-back beach living. Known for its picturesque beaches, vibrant arts scene, and historic downtown area, Ventura is a destination that has something to offer for everyone. From outdoor enthusiasts to art aficionados, this charming city has it all.

One of the biggest draws of Ventura is its miles of pristine beaches. With the Pacific Ocean as its backdrop, Ventura boasts some of the most beautiful stretches of sand in California. Surfers flock to spots like Surfer’s Point to catch the perfect wave, while sunbathers bask in the warm California sun at spots like San Buenaventura State Beach. Beachcombers can stroll along the Ventura Pier and take in breathtaking views of the ocean and coastline, or explore the tide pools at Emma Wood State Beach. Whether you’re looking to relax on the sand or get your adrenaline pumping with water sports, Ventura’s beaches are a paradise for beach lovers.

Aside from its natural beauty, Ventura also has a rich cultural scene that draws visitors from near and far. The city’s historic downtown area is a hub for artists and creatives, with galleries, studios, and boutiques lining its charming streets. Visitors can explore the Museum of Ventura County to learn about the city’s history and culture, or catch a performance at the Majestic Ventura Theater. The city is also home to a thriving food and drink scene, with trendy restaurants, craft breweries, and wine bars offering a taste of Ventura’s culinary diversity.

For those looking to get active, Ventura offers a plethora of outdoor activities to enjoy. Hiking enthusiasts can explore the trails of the Ventura Botanical Gardens or take a scenic bike ride along the Ventura River Trail. Water lovers can kayak through the picturesque Ventura Harbor or go whale watching off the coast of Channel Islands National Park. With its mild climate and breathtaking scenery, Ventura is a playground for outdoor adventurers.

Ventura is also a destination for history buffs, with a number of historic sites and landmarks to explore. The Olivas Adobe is a must-see for those interested in California’s Spanish colonial history, while the Ventura County Museum of Art and History offers a glimpse into the city’s past. Visitors can also tour the historic San Buenaventura Mission, founded in 1782, and learn about the city’s Spanish heritage. Ventura’s historic buildings and architecture provide a window into its storied past, making it a fascinating destination for history lovers.

In addition to its natural beauty and cultural attractions, Ventura also has a vibrant community spirit that sets it apart from other California cities. The city hosts a variety of festivals and events throughout the year, celebrating everything from art and music to food and wine. The Ventura County Fair is a beloved summertime tradition, while the ArtWalk and Music Under the Stars events showcase the city’s artistic talent. Ventura’s farmers markets offer a taste of local produce and artisan goods, while its street fairs and parades bring the community together in celebration.
